Thread: BUG #14307: SELECT from pg_timezone_abbrevs gives an ERROR: F0000
BUG #14307: SELECT from pg_timezone_abbrevs gives an ERROR: F0000
From
neil@postgrescompare.com
Date:
VGhlIGZvbGxvd2luZyBidWcgaGFzIGJlZW4gbG9nZ2VkIG9uIHRoZSB3ZWJz aXRlOgoKQnVnIHJlZmVyZW5jZTogICAgICAxNDMwNwpMb2dnZWQgYnk6ICAg ICAgICAgIE5laWwgQW5kZXJzb24KRW1haWwgYWRkcmVzczogICAgICBuZWls QHBvc3RncmVzY29tcGFyZS5jb20KUG9zdGdyZVNRTCB2ZXJzaW9uOiA5LjZi ZXRhNApPcGVyYXRpbmcgc3lzdGVtOiAgIFdpbmRvd3MgMTAgRW50ZXJwcmlz ZSBOICg2NCBiaXQpCkRlc2NyaXB0aW9uOiAgICAgICAgCgpIaSwNCg0KTXkg cHJvamVjdCBxdWVyaWVzIG1vc3Qgb2YgdGhlIHN5c3RlbSBjYXRhbG9ncyBh bmQgaGl0IGFuIGlzc3VlIHdpdGggOS42cmMxCm9uIFdpbmRvd3MgMTAuIA0K DQpTdGVwcyB0byByZXByb2R1Y2U6DQoxLiBTdGFydCBwc3FsDQoyLiBTRUxF Q1QgKiBmcm9tIHBnX3RpbWV6b25lX2FiYnJldnM7DQoNCkV4cGVjdGVkOg0K RGF0YSBmcm9tIHBnX3RpbWV6b25lX2FiYnJldnMgdG8gYmUgcmV0dXJuZWQN Cg0KQWN0dWFsOg0KRVJST1I6IEYwMDAwOiB0aW1lIHpvbmUgYWJicmV2aWF0 aW9uICJub3ZzdCIgaXMgbm90IHVzZWQgaW4gdGltZSB6b25lCiJBc2lhL05v dm9zaWJpcnNrIg0KDQpTZXR0aW5nIHZlcmJvc2UgcG9pbnRzIHRvIGxpbmUg MTc1MCBvZiBkYXRldGltZS5jCmh0dHBzOi8vZ2l0aHViLmNvbS9wb3N0Z3Jl cy9wb3N0Z3Jlcy9ibG9iL1JFTDlfNl9SQzEvc3JjL2JhY2tlbmQvdXRpbHMv YWR0L2RhdGV0aW1lLmMjTDE3NTANCg0KUmVnYXJkcywNCk5laWwNCg0KSGVy ZSBpcyB0aGUgZnVsbCBleGNlcHRpb24gZGF0YToNCiRleGNlcHRpb24NCntO cGdzcWwuUG9zdGdyZXNFeGNlcHRpb246IEYwMDAwOiB0aW1lIHpvbmUgYWJi cmV2aWF0aW9uICJub3ZzdCIgaXMgbm90IHVzZWQKaW4gdGltZSB6b25lICJB c2lhL05vdm9zaWJpcnNrIg0KICAgYXQgTnBnc3FsLk5wZ3NxbENvbm5lY3Rv ci5Eb1JlYWRNZXNzYWdlKERhdGFSb3dMb2FkaW5nTW9kZQpkYXRhUm93TG9h ZGluZ01vZGUsIEJvb2xlYW4gaXNQcmVwZW5kZWRNZXNzYWdlKQ0KICAgYXQg TnBnc3FsLk5wZ3NxbENvbm5lY3Rvci5SZWFkTWVzc2FnZVdpdGhQcmVwZW5k ZWQoRGF0YVJvd0xvYWRpbmdNb2RlCmRhdGFSb3dMb2FkaW5nTW9kZSkNCiAg IGF0IE5wZ3NxbC5OcGdzcWxEYXRhUmVhZGVyLk5leHRSZXN1bHRJbnRlcm5h bCgpDQogICBhdCBOcGdzcWwuTnBnc3FsRGF0YVJlYWRlci5OZXh0UmVzdWx0 KCkNCiAgIGF0IE5wZ3NxbC5OcGdzcWxDb21tYW5kLkV4ZWN1dGUoQ29tbWFu ZEJlaGF2aW9yIGJlaGF2aW9yKQ0KICAgYXQgTnBnc3FsLk5wZ3NxbENvbW1h bmQuRXhlY3V0ZURiRGF0YVJlYWRlckludGVybmFsKENvbW1hbmRCZWhhdmlv cgpiZWhhdmlvcikNCiAgIGF0IE9iamVjdE1vZGVsLkRhdGFiYXNlTW9kZWxC dWlsZGVyLlJlYWQoSURiQ29ubmVjdGlvbiBjb25uZWN0aW9uLApBY3Rpb25g MSBvYmplY3RDcmVhdGVkLCBTdHJpbmcgcXVlcnksIFR5cGUgdHlwZVRvQ3Jl YXRlKSBpbgpDOlxVc2Vyc1xlbmVpYW5kXGRldlxwb3N0Z3Jlc3FsY29tcGFy ZVxkb3RuZXRjb3JlXHNyY1xtb2RlbHNcRGF0YWJhc2VNb2RlbEJ1aWxkZXIu Y3M6bGluZQoxMDINCiAgIGF0IE9iamVjdE1vZGVsLkRhdGFiYXNlTW9kZWxC dWlsZGVyLkJ1aWxkKElEYkNvbm5lY3Rpb24gZGJDb25uZWN0aW9uKSBpbgpD OlxVc2Vyc1xlbmVpYW5kXGRldlxwb3N0Z3Jlc3FsY29tcGFyZVxkb3RuZXRj b3JlXHNyY1xtb2RlbHNcRGF0YWJhc2VNb2RlbEJ1aWxkZXIuY3M6bGluZQo4 Ng0KICAgYXQgSW50ZWdyYXRpb25UZXN0cy5UZXN0RnJhbWV3b3JrLlV0aWxp dGllcy5HZXREYXRhYmFzZXMoRGF0YWJhc2VTY2hlbWEKc2NoZW1hWCwgRGF0 YWJhc2VTY2hlbWEgc2NoZW1hWSkgaW4KQzpcVXNlcnNcZW5laWFuZFxkZXZc cG9zdGdyZXNxbGNvbXBhcmVcZG90bmV0Y29yZVx0ZXN0XGludGVncmF0aW9u XHRlc3RmcmFtZXdvcmtcVXRpbGl0aWVzLmNzOmxpbmUKNjYNCiAgIGF0IElu dGVncmF0aW9uVGVzdHMuVGVzdEZyYW1ld29yay5VdGlsaXRpZXMuR2V0Q29t cGFyaXNvbihEYXRhYmFzZVNjaGVtYQpzY2hlbWFYLCBEYXRhYmFzZVNjaGVt YSBzY2hlbWFZLCBTdHJpbmcgY29tcGFyaXNvbk5hbWUpIGluCkM6XFVzZXJz XGVuZWlhbmRcZGV2XHBvc3RncmVzcWxjb21wYXJlXGRvdG5ldGNvcmVcdGVz dFxpbnRlZ3JhdGlvblx0ZXN0ZnJhbWV3b3JrXFV0aWxpdGllcy5jczpsaW5l CjQwDQogICBhdCBJbnRlZ3JhdGlvblRlc3RzLkNvbXBhcmlzb24uQ29sdW1u Q29tcGFyaXNvbi5CYXNpY0lkZW50aWNhbFRlc3QoKSBpbgpDOlxVc2Vyc1xl bmVpYW5kXGRldlxwb3N0Z3Jlc3FsY29tcGFyZVxkb3RuZXRjb3JlXHRlc3Rc aW50ZWdyYXRpb25cY29tcGFyaXNvblxDb2x1bW5Db21wYXJpc29uLmNzOmxp bmUKMTR9DQogICAgQmFzZU1lc3NhZ2U6ICJ0aW1lIHpvbmUgYWJicmV2aWF0 aW9uIFwibm92c3RcIiBpcyBub3QgdXNlZCBpbiB0aW1lIHpvbmUKXCJBc2lh L05vdm9zaWJpcnNrXCIiDQogICAgQ29kZTogIkYwMDAwIg0KICAgIENvbHVt bk5hbWU6IG51bGwNCiAgICBDb25zdHJhaW50TmFtZTogbnVsbA0KICAgIERh dGE6IENvdW50ID0gOA0KICAgIERhdGFUeXBlTmFtZTogbnVsbA0KICAgIERl dGFpbDogbnVsbA0KICAgIEZpbGU6ICJkYXRldGltZS5jIg0KICAgIEhSZXN1 bHQ6IC0yMTQ2MjMzMDg4DQogICAgSGVscExpbms6IG51bGwNCiAgICBIaW50 OiBudWxsDQogICAgSW5uZXJFeGNlcHRpb246IG51bGwNCiAgICBJbnRlcm5h bFBvc2l0aW9uOiAwDQogICAgSW50ZXJuYWxRdWVyeTogbnVsbA0KICAgIExp bmU6ICIxNzUwIg0KICAgIE1lc3NhZ2U6ICJGMDAwMDogdGltZSB6b25lIGFi YnJldmlhdGlvbiBcIm5vdnN0XCIgaXMgbm90IHVzZWQgaW4gdGltZQp6b25l IFwiQXNpYS9Ob3Zvc2liaXJza1wiIg0KICAgIE1lc3NhZ2VUZXh0OiAidGlt ZSB6b25lIGFiYnJldmlhdGlvbiBcIm5vdnN0XCIgaXMgbm90IHVzZWQgaW4g dGltZSB6b25lClwiQXNpYS9Ob3Zvc2liaXJza1wiIg0KICAgIFBvc2l0aW9u OiAwDQogICAgUm91dGluZTogIkRldGVybWluZVRpbWVab25lQWJicmV2T2Zm c2V0SW50ZXJuYWwiDQogICAgU2NoZW1hTmFtZTogbnVsbA0KICAgIFNldmVy aXR5OiAiRVJST1IiDQogICAgU291cmNlOiAiTnBnc3FsIg0KICAgIFNxbFN0 YXRlOiAiRjAwMDAiDQogICAgU3RhY2tUcmFjZTogIiAgIGF0Ck5wZ3NxbC5O cGdzcWxDb25uZWN0b3IuRG9SZWFkTWVzc2FnZShEYXRhUm93TG9hZGluZ01v ZGUgZGF0YVJvd0xvYWRpbmdNb2RlLApCb29sZWFuIGlzUHJlcGVuZGVkTWVz c2FnZSlcclxuICAgYXQKTnBnc3FsLk5wZ3NxbENvbm5lY3Rvci5SZWFkTWVz c2FnZVdpdGhQcmVwZW5kZWQoRGF0YVJvd0xvYWRpbmdNb2RlCmRhdGFSb3dM b2FkaW5nTW9kZSlcclxuICAgYXQKTnBnc3FsLk5wZ3NxbERhdGFSZWFkZXIu TmV4dFJlc3VsdEludGVybmFsKClcclxuICAgYXQKTnBnc3FsLk5wZ3NxbERh dGFSZWFkZXIuTmV4dFJlc3VsdCgpXHJcbiAgIGF0Ck5wZ3NxbC5OcGdzcWxD b21tYW5kLkV4ZWN1dGUoQ29tbWFuZEJlaGF2aW9yIGJlaGF2aW9yKVxyXG4g ICBhdApOcGdzcWwuTnBnc3FsQ29tbWFuZC5FeGVjdXRlRGJEYXRhUmVhZGVy SW50ZXJuYWwoQ29tbWFuZEJlaGF2aW9yCmJlaGF2aW9yKVxyXG4gICBhdCBP YmplY3RNb2RlbC5EYXRhYmFzZU1vZGVsQnVpbGRlci5SZWFkKElEYkNvbm5l Y3Rpb24KY29ubmVjdGlvbiwgQWN0aW9uYDEgb2JqZWN0Q3JlYXRlZCwgU3Ry aW5nIHF1ZXJ5LCBUeXBlIHR5cGVUb0NyZWF0ZSkgaW4KQzpcXFVzZXJzXFxl bmVpYW5kXFxkZXZcXHBvc3RncmVzcWxjb21wYXJlXFxkb3RuZXRjb3JlXFxz cmNcXG1vZGVsc1xcRGF0YWJhc2VNb2RlbEJ1aWxkZXIuY3M6bGluZQoxMDJc clxuICAgYXQgT2JqZWN0TW9kZWwuRGF0YWJhc2VNb2RlbEJ1aWxkZXIuQnVp bGQoSURiQ29ubmVjdGlvbgpkYkNvbm5lY3Rpb24pIGluCkM6XFxVc2Vyc1xc ZW5laWFuZFxcZGV2XFxwb3N0Z3Jlc3FsY29tcGFyZVxcZG90bmV0Y29yZVxc c3JjXFxtb2RlbHNcXERhdGFiYXNlTW9kZWxCdWlsZGVyLmNzOmxpbmUKODZc clxuICAgYXQKSW50ZWdyYXRpb25UZXN0cy5UZXN0RnJhbWV3b3JrLlV0aWxp dGllcy5HZXREYXRhYmFzZXMoRGF0YWJhc2VTY2hlbWEKc2NoZW1hWCwgRGF0 YWJhc2VTY2hlbWEgc2NoZW1hWSkgaW4gQzpcXFVzZXJzXFxlbmVpYW5kXFxk ZXZcXA0KcG9zdGdyZXNxbGNvbXBhcmVcXGRvdG5ldGNvcmVcXHRlc3RcXGlu dGVncmF0aW9uXFx0ZXN0ZnJhbWV3b3JrXFxVdGlsaXRpZXMuY3M6bGluZQo2 NlxyXG4gICBhdApJbnRlZ3JhdGlvblRlc3RzLlRlc3RGcmFtZXdvcmsuVXRp bGl0aWVzLkdldENvbXBhcmlzb24oRGF0YWJhc2VTY2hlbWEKc2NoZW1hWCwg RGF0YWJhc2VTY2hlbWEgc2NoZW1hWSwgU3RyaW5nIGNvbXBhcmlzb25OYW1l KSBpbgpDOlxcVXNlcnNcXGVuZWlhbmRcXGRldlxccG9zdGdyZXNxbGNvbXBh cmVcXGRvdG5ldGNvcmVcXHRlc3RcXGludGVncmF0aW9uXFx0ZXN0ZnJhbWV3 b3JrXFxVdGlsaXRpZXMuY3M6bGluZQo0MFxyXG4gICBhdApJbnRlZ3JhdGlv blRlc3RzLkNvbXBhcmlzb24uQ29sdW1uQ29tcGFyaXNvbi5CYXNpY0lkZW50 aWNhbFRlc3QoKSBpbgpDOlxcVXNlcnNcXGVuZWlhbmRcXGRldlxccG9zdGdy ZXNxbGNvbXBhcmVcXGRvdG5ldGNvcmVcXHRlc3RcXGludGVncmF0aW9uXFxj b21wYXJpc29uXFxDb2x1bW5Db21wYXJpc29uLmNzOmxpbmUKMTQiDQogICAg U3RhdGVtZW50OiB7U0VMRUNUIGFiYnJldiwgdXRjX29mZnNldCwgaXNfZHN0 IEZST00gcGdfdGltZXpvbmVfYWJicmV2cwp9DQogICAgVGFibGVOYW1lOiBu dWxsDQogICAgV2hlcmU6IG51bGwNCg0KCgo=
On 2016-09-01 11:15 PM, neil@postgrescompare.com wrote: > The following bug has been logged on the website: > > Bug reference: 14307 > Logged by: Neil Anderson > Email address: neil@postgrescompare.com > PostgreSQL version: 9.6beta4 > Operating system: Windows 10 Enterprise N (64 bit) > Description: > > Hi, > > My project queries most of the system catalogs and hit an issue with 9.6rc1 > on Windows 10. Further to this the same error appears in 9.5.4 but not in 9.5.3 -- Neil Anderson neil@postgrescompare.com http://blog.postgrescompare.com
neil@postgrescompare.com writes: > 2. SELECT * from pg_timezone_abbrevs; > ERROR: F0000: time zone abbreviation "novst" is not used in time zone > "Asia/Novosibirsk" Hm, yeah, IANA changed the data they ship for Asia/Novosibirsk and we missed the impact it would have on our stuff :-(. I've started a thread on what to do about this over in pgsql-hackers: https://www.postgresql.org/message-id/flat/6189.1472820913%40sss.pgh.pa.us Thanks for the report! regards, tom lane